Care and maintenance

Regular cleaning
Wipe with a soft cloth.
If the equipment is visibly soiled
Soak a soft cloth in a mild detergent
diluted with water, wring it out thoroughly,
and wipe the equipment gently. Do not
use any form of cleaning spray.
